Output 57868d413c4af25269e6ce35f3cd881842c7c3f48469826016ecf32c0e5a4d04:0

value
97975
script pubkey
OP_0 OP_PUSHBYTES_20 667bf7df8ba04103de11d4026ef5ac66c5d8c6a0
address
bc1qveal0hut5pqs8hs36spxaadvvmza334qxm3tu7
transaction
57868d413c4af25269e6ce35f3cd881842c7c3f48469826016ecf32c0e5a4d04
spent
true